A deleted protected page here on WikiIndex is an article (or category) page that is the target of being repeatedly recreated, and is typically spam or other off-topic material. When an administrator discovers constantly recreated pages, they protect it so that only sysops can (re)create it.

Instructions

For users

  1. Nominate the offending page for deletion by adding {{Delete}} at the top of the edit box on said page, and wait for an admin to delete it.

For admins

  1. Block the editor who created said unwanted article or category page;
  2. Delete the said unwanted article or category page;
  3. Protect the title so that only admins may recreate the page
  4. If the user was a spammer, edit my spam blacklist and add the basic URL
